Preferably, the rear surrounds should be slightly elevated and angled towards all listeners. The first pic might be okay for one person sitting in the middle but would be annoying to anyone sitting on either end of the couch.

No reason at all to have a 7.1 system in this situation. Set it up as a 5.1 system (not using rear surrounds as they will be of little if any audible benefit in your situation) and if possible move the couch away from the wall 1'. By doing that and placing your surround speakers in the corner of the room, at ceiling height, aimed towards the listeners position(s), you should get amazing sound.
